'Nitish Kumar To Meet The Governor Today After NDA's Key Meet, Swearing-In Ceremony Likely To Be Held Tomorrow': JD(U) State President

JD(U) State President spoke to ABP News and said that Nitish Kumar is likely to meet the Bihar Governor today and can submit the proposal to form the government.

Ahead Of NDA's decision to re-elect Nitish Kumar as the Chief Minister of Bihar, the JD(U) state President Vashshitha Narayan Singh hinted on the swearing-in ceremony date while speaking to ABP News. Vashishtha Narayan Singh said that Nitish Kumar will meet the governor of Bihar today and will submit the proposal to form the government. Singh also said," Tomorrow (16 November) is a good day to hold the swearing-in ceremony." Bihar has been awaiting NDA's decision for the new Chief Minister of the state after the Nitish Kumar led alliance emerged victorious in the Bihar Election results. The National Democratic Alliance (NDA) leaders will meet at 12.30 pm on Sunday to formally choose its leader in Bihar, chief minister Nitish Kumar said on Saturday. Defence Minister Rajnath Singh will be a part of the meeting. NDA leaders had gathered at Kumar’s residence on Friday for informal interaction, the first such event after the election results were declared on November 10. The NDA, which comprises the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P), Janata Dal (United), Hindustani Awam Morcha-Secular (HAM) and the Vikassheel Insaan Party (VIP), won 125 seats in the 243-member assembly with the BJP alone winning 74 seats.
